Definitive Swim is a free download album released in 2007 by hip-hop label Definitive Jux in collaboration with animation channel Adult Swim and Old Spice.[1] The compilation contains unreleased music from the majority of the label's current roster. The announcement of the compilation was also used to launch the video for El-P's single "Flyentology", which was animated by Williams Street animators Daniel Garcia and Nathan Love. It is to be noted that all of the tracks are the edited versions.
Track listing
- "Plot for a Little" - Camu Tao – 2:55
- "Smithereens (Stop Cryin)" - El-P – 4:34
- "Brand New Vandals" - Rob Sonic – 3:52
- "Think Big" - Hangar 18 – 3:34
- "Brothaz remix" - Mr. Lif and Cannibal Ox – 5:13
- "Get Rich or Try Dying" - Despot – 4:09
- "Get with the Times" - Cool Calm Pete – 4:06
- "Red October" - Mr. Lif – 2:48
- "Blood Boy" - Cage – 4:11
- "None Shall Pass" - Aesop Rock – 4:03
